Plato and Aristotle. Grinder traces the origins of Educational Psychology to Plato who believed thatall knowledge is innate at birth and is perfectible by experiential learningduring growth. Aristotle, Plato's student, was the first to observe that "association"among ideas facilitated understanding and recall.
